Overview of Deep House musician Max Abysmal

Max Abysmal is an electronic music producer from Sydney, Australia, who specializes in the deep house subgenre. Abysmal has made a name for himself in the electronic music field by combining addictive beats with lyrical melodies in a distinctive way that captivates listeners.

Abysmal has developed a distinctive sound that skillfully combines parts of electronic music with the rhythmic grooves of deep house, drawing inspiration from a wide range of musical genres. His music has an unmistakable intensity that carries listeners to blissful worlds where the music acts as a conduit for enlightenment.

Each track of Abysmal's music is meticulously designed to produce a dynamic and immersive experience, showcasing his exceptional producing abilities. Which are the most important music performances and festival appearances for Deep House musician Max Abysmal?

Max Abysmal is a well-known electronic and deep house artist from Sydney, Australia, who has performed at a number of festivals and venues throughout the world. Distortion, Dekmantel Festival, Paraiso Festival, One Love Festival, and Mandala Festival are a few of his best festival appearances. Max Abysmal has been given the opportunity by these events to display his distinctive sound and mesmerize audiences with his performances.

At Razzmatazz, a renowned venue famed for its lively atmosphere and cutting-edge music, he gave one of his highlight performances. At Razzmatazz, Max Abysmal took the crowd on a journey through deep house and electronic beats while flawlessly fusing different genres. The vivacious throng reacted with enthusiasm, dancing to the contagious beats and getting swept up in the music.

Another noteworthy concert took place at the famous TivoliVredenburg in the center of Utrecht, Netherlands. Max Abysmal performed a captivating set that demonstrated his artistic flexibility. The excellent sound system at the venue accentuated the impact of his music, generating an exciting ambiance that made an impression on the audience.

Max Abysmal has also performed on the stages of De School Amsterdam, Corsica Studios, and Thuishaven, among other venues, in addition to these outstanding performances. He has been able to share his love of electronic and deep house music with each audience member during each performance.
